Founder Validation Copilot
A SaaS tool that guides solo founders through small, repeatable validation experiments before and after launch. It reduces the emotional weight of rejection by turning outreach, responses, and failed tests into structured learning loops.
Pourquoi c'est important
You know you should talk to potential users earlier, but each outreach message feels like a personal test of whether your idea and your skills are good enough. That pressure pushes you back into building mode, where progress feels safer but market learning stalls. When you finally reach out, weak replies or silence are hard to interpret, so you either overreact and quit or keep polishing without evidence. What you need is not another generic productivity app. You need a system that breaks validation into small actions, captures what happened, and tells you what the result actually means so you can keep moving without turning every response into an emotional crisis.

Périmètre MVP · 1–2 semaines
- Build onboarding that asks idea, audience, stage, and current validation blockers
- Create experiment templates for interview outreach, pricing tests, and landing page feedback
- Add a daily action queue with one small validation task per day
- Implement response logging with categories for silence, interest, objection, and purchase intent
- Launch a simple dashboard showing experiments run and outcomes
- Add AI-assisted message drafting for outreach and follow-up
- Build experiment review that recommends continue, revise, or stop
- Create project rules such as minimum outreach volume before judging failure
- Integrate Stripe for subscriptions and a lightweight paywall
- Recruit beta users and observe whether they complete tasks without manual coaching

Pourquoi cela pourrait échouer
Auto-contre-argument — le signal de confiance le plus important
- 1Founders may say they want validation help but still avoid using the tool when outreach discomfort appears
- 2The product may be judged on users' business outcomes even when weak execution caused the poor result
- 3General-purpose AI tools may satisfy enough of the need unless this product offers stronger workflow and benchmarking
